When a company is wanting to come to Colorado, and pays over $10 million more for a property that was just purchased earlier that year, you know they mean business. With there being less and less Kodak-related work happening in Windsor, this new company may be the town’s “next big thing.”
in February of 2025, well-known Northern Colorado developer Martin Lind purchased the former Carestream Health property for $3.5 million. In December of 2025, he sold that property to GlobalAI for $15.6 million. That is a lot of money; that definitely infers “deep pockets” putting some roots down in the area.

GlobaAI, which, according to BizWest, designs and operates high-performance, liquid-cooled data centers purpose-built for advanced AI workloads. To achieve that high-performance, it does take a lot of water and electricity. Some are excited about new technology coming to the area, others are concerned about the demands…..
